In a recent rally, a prominent Republican leader emphasized the growing strength and unity of the Republican Party, claiming it is more vibrant than ever. The leader highlighted the influx of diverse groups joining the party, including African Americans, Hispanic Americans, and union members, framing this as a movement of \"common sense\" in contrast to what he described as the chaos within the Democratic Party.
The speaker criticized President Joe Biden and Vice President Kamala Harris, suggesting that the Democratic Party is struggling to find a suitable candidate for the presidency. He claimed that Biden's performance in a recent debate was so poor that it has led some within his party to consider urging him to withdraw from the race. The leader asserted that even mainstream media outlets acknowledged his own strong performance during the debate.
In a bold move, he extended a challenge to Biden for a second debate, proposing it be conducted without moderators to allow for a more direct confrontation. Additionally, he suggested a golf match at a renowned course, offering Biden a significant handicap of ten strokes, and pledged a $1 million donation to a charity of Biden's choice if he wins.
The speaker also took aim at Biden's credibility, accusing him of fabricating personal experiences and failing to effectively manage key issues, including border security, which he claimed Harris has neglected. He concluded by acknowledging Harris's selection as Biden's running mate as a strategic decision, suggesting it was a protective measure for Biden's presidency.
